Chemical Engineering is the 64th most popular major in the country with 12,690 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across Oklahoma, there were 182 chemical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 157 chemical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$40,150 and $25,612 respectively.

Out of the 3 schools in the Most Veteran Friendly in Oklahoma for Chem Eng for a Bachelor’s that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Oklahoma Norman Campus landed the #1 spot on the list. University of Oklahoma is a large public school situated in Norman, Oklahoma. It awarded 70 bachelors’s chem eng degrees in 2020-2021.

University of Oklahoma did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best Chemical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Oklahoma” list.Our most recent data shows that 12 of the 27,772 students enrolled at University of Oklahoma were GI Bill® students, of which 10 were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average Post-9/11 GI Bill® award for tuition and fees at the school was $3,720. In addition to receiving other benefits, 0 students received scholarships through the Yellow Ribbon Program. Eligible students may be able to receive credit for their military training.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Oklahoma State University - Main Campus.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Most Veteran Friendly in Oklahoma for Chem Eng for a Bachelor’s list. This large school is located in Stillwater, Oklahoma, and it awarded 58 bachelors’s chem eng degrees in 2020-2021.

OSU not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#2 on our “Best Chemical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Oklahoma” list.Of the 24,535 students enrolled at OSU, 1,038 were GI Bill® students, according to our most recent data. Out of that number, 439 were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average tuition and fees award for the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ients was $7,226. To help with additional expenses, 39 students received scholarships through the Yellow Ribbon Program. OSU does offer credit for military training for eligible students.

The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 85%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year. Out of the 3 schools in the Most Veteran Friendly in Oklahoma for Chem Eng for a Bachelor’s that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Tulsa landed the #3 spot on the list. University of Tulsa is a small school located in Tulsa, Oklahoma that handed out 29 bachelors’s chem eng degrees in 2020-2021.

University of Tulsa did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#3 on our “Best Chemical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Oklahoma” list.Among the 3,960 students enrolled at University of Tulsa, 119 are GI Bill® students, according to our most recent data. Out of that number, 62 were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average Post-9/11 GI Bill® award for tuition and fees at the school was $17,162. On top of their other funding sources, 19 students received funds through the Yellow Ribbon Program.
